
Creaform VXremote
Worldwide leader in portable 3D measurement technologies Creaform has announced the release of VXremote, its remote access software application.
The system has been produced with Creaform-certified rugged tablets (7 in. or 10 in. tablets) and increases user efficiency in the field by providing fast and easy remote access to VXelements, the 3D software platform that powers Creaform’s entire fleet of 3D scanning and measurement technologies.
VXremote enables users to better visualise real-time scanned data and change parameters—even when they are far from their laptops. VXremote is particularly useful when scanning large objects or when the scanning has to be performed in constrained or remote areas. Examples of reverse engineering and quality control projects with which the VXremote can provide remote scanning capabilities and improve efficiency - without sacrificing data quality - include:
- Airplanes, cars, boats, trains, trucks
- Refineries, pressure vessels and large diameter pipes
- Industrial installations
- Outdoor heritage, art, or natural objects
- Harness, rope, or platform access scanning
VXremote features a simplified process to connect the tablet to the computer and does not require users to have internet access to log into their accounts.
In addition, as VXremote is optimised with VXelements, it automatically diagnoses connection issues and provides detailed messages to help resolve issues. VXremote is also architecture-ready for future updates.
At the same time as the VXremote release, Creaform announced the availability of a brand-new 3D scanner external battery. This optional battery helps users to use Creaform's 3D scanners when access to electricity is unavailable or too far away, which ultimately increases mobility for outdoor applications as well as scanning large parts or products that are in remote locations.
